Understanding Sonar Technology and Its Benefits
Sonar technology functions as the backbone of modern fish finders, helping anglers identify underwater structures and schools of fish with precision. This technology employs sound waves to create precise images of the aquatic environment. By sending out sound pulses and examining their echoes, sonar systems are able to identify the depth, dimensions, and makeup of objects below the surface.
Two main categories of sonar exist: conventional 2D sonar and sophisticated 3D sonar. Whereas 2D sonar offers essential depth readings and fish location details, 3D sonar delivers a significantly more detailed picture, displaying subsurface terrain features and fish activity. Such data empowers anglers to make educated determinations about ideal fishing areas and approaches.

Display Format Options
When choosing a fish finder, fishermen should carefully consider the different display types on the market, as they considerably influence functionality and usability. The key options include LCD, LED, and OLED displays. LCD screens are common and offer excellent readability in diverse lighting conditions, while LED displays offer improved brightness and greater energy efficiency. OLED screens, though typically more expensive, deliver exceptional contrast and precise color reproduction, making them more readable in bright sunlight. Frequency and Transducer Types: Everything You Should Know
How can anglers choose the right frequency and transducer type for their fishing needs? Picking the correct frequency is fundamental, as it directly affects the fish finder's performance in various water conditions. Elevated frequencies, generally spanning between 200 kHz and 400 kHz, offer superior detail and work best in shallow waters, revealing structures and fish more clearly. On the other hand, lower-range frequencies, including 50 kHz, reach deeper water depths more effectively, rendering them ideal for offshore fishing scenarios where depths surpass 100 feet.
Transducer varieties also have a considerable impact. Standard transducers are built for traditional sonar detection, while CHIRP (Compressed High-Intensity Radiated Pulse) transducers offer enhanced target separation and clarity. Additionally, some transducers come with multiple frequency options, enabling fishermen to adjust to varying fishing conditions. How to Fine-Tune Fish Finder Settings for Better Performance
Adjusting sonar settings can greatly improve an fisherman's success on the water. To achieve optimal performance, anglers should begin by adjusting the calibrating the frequency based on their specific fishing conditions. A higher frequency provides more accurate imagery in shallower depths, while reduced frequencies are ideal for deeper waters. Next, the sensitivity setting should be tailored to maximize target visibility; boosting sensitivity can aid in detecting fish in cloudy conditions, while too high a setting may crowd the readout.
In addition, employing the correct display mode—either conventional 2D sonar or advanced options like CHIRP—can increase picture quality. How Do I Maintain My Fish Finder for Longevity?
To maintain a fish finder in good condition, routinely clean the transducer, steer clear of extreme temperatures, ensure proper storage, maintain updated software, and examine connections for signs of corrosion. Adhering to these steps can greatly extend the device's lifespan and functionality.
